摘要
Two new complexes formulated as [HgBr(bimt)(mu-Br)(2)HgBr(bimt)]center dot H2O (1), and [HgI(bimt)(mu-I)(2)HgI(bimt)] (2) (bimt = 2-((benzoimidazolyl)methyl)-1H-tetrazole) have been synthesized and characterized by elemental analysis, IR spectra, and single-crystal X-ray diffraction. Both complexes exhibit binuclear structure. In the solid state, there are hydrogen bonds and p-p interactions in both complexes, and there are still I center dot center dot center dot I interactions in 2. Their fluorescent properties also have been determined.
